Quantum engineering has a high academic barrier because it combines advanced physics with practical engineering. Most people specialize through a physics, electrical-engineering or materials-science degree and laboratory work.

The decisive gate is evidence of experimental or technical depth: a research placement, fabrication experience, software contribution or graduate project that shows more than familiarity with buzzwords.

Physics or engineering degree plus graduate study $50k–$250k+

Costs range from publicly funded graduate stipends to expensive US undergraduate degrees. Research assistantships often fund doctoral study, but the opportunity cost is substantial.

The other way in

Semiconductor engineering transition

RF, nanofabrication and test engineers can move into quantum-device teams through platform training.

Scientific software route

Experienced simulation or control developers can enter quantum software and instrumentation roles.
